Visualisation Tool
Notice Description
This project aims to implement a digital model of UKAEA estate records and facilities to enhance visualisation, collaboration, and overall management efficiency. The focus will be on creating an accurate and up-to-date baseline model of the site for immediate visualisation, planning, and presentation use-cases, and subsequently integrating or interfacing with real-time data, predictive analytics, and advanced visualisation tools. Adopting a digital model and fostering collaboration can transform how UKAEA manage and maintain our estate. It leads to better visualisation, planning, predictive maintenance, efficient space utilisation, energy management, lifecycle management, and enhanced stakeholder collaboration. These improvements not only drive operational efficiency and cost savings but also support sustainability and improved occupant experiences. Open Contracting Data Standard (OCDS)
The Open Contracting Data Standard (OCDS) is a framework designed to increase transparency and access to public procurement data in the public sector. It is widely used by governments and organisations worldwide to report on procurement processes and contracts.
